#520e43 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#520e43 is composed of 32.2% red, 5.5%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 82.9% magenta, 18.3% yellow and 67.8% black. It has a hue angle of 313.2 degrees, a saturation of 70.8% and a lightness of 18.8%. #520e43 color hex could be obtained by blending #a41c86 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

Shades and Tints of #520e43

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f030c is the darkest color, while #fffd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#520e43

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#312f30 is the less saturated color, while #5d0349 is the most saturated one.
